Bad Day Better Pancakes
2 C. flour
4 tbsps. sugar
4 tsps. Baking powder
1 tsp. salt
2 C. milk
4 Tbsp. Melted butter
2 eggs
2 Tbsp. oil
Chocolate chips (it varies. Some weeks we use one cup, others two. This week was a two-cup week.)
Mix all the above in a large mixing bowl until blended.
Preheat a griddle to 300-350 degrees.
If you love pancakes, invest in a griddle.
I cannot make pancakes in a frying pan.
Plus, if you are making for a family, it is hard to keep warm and make new ones all at once.
Another plus?
Grilled cheese on a griddle is superb.
As the griddle is preheating, take a pat of butter/margarine and rub it all over the griddle.
Then take a 1/2 C. measuring cup and dole out your pancakes onto the griddle.
Two minutes per side is my lucky number.
